首页 话题 小组 问答 好文 用户 我的社区 域名交易 唠叨

[教程]Python代码中的三引号如何输入?

发布于 2025-12-02 03:30:30
0
1239

在Python中,三引号(''' 或 quot;quot;quot;)用于定义多行字符串。这些引号可以用于单行或跨多行的字符串。下面将详细介绍如何使用三引号来输入字符串。...

在Python中,三引号('''""")用于定义多行字符串。这些引号可以用于单行或跨多行的字符串。下面将详细介绍如何使用三引号来输入字符串。

单行三引号字符串

要定义一个单行三引号字符串,只需要在字符串的开始和结束处使用三个相同的引号即可:

single_line_string = '''这是一个单行字符串'''
print(single_line_string)

输出结果:

这是一个单行字符串

多行三引号字符串

要定义一个多行字符串,可以在字符串的开始和结束处使用三个相同的引号,并在其中换行:

multi_line_string = '''
这是一个多行
字符串的示例
'''
print(multi_line_string)

输出结果:

这是一个多行
字符串的示例

三引号字符串中包含引号

当需要在三引号字符串中包含引号时,可以在引号前加上一个反斜杠(\)来转义引号:

string_with_quotes = '''
这是一个包含
"引号"的字符串
'''
print(string_with_quotes)

输出结果:

这是一个包含
"引号"的字符串

三引号字符串的用途

三引号字符串在Python中有很多用途,以下是一些常见的场景:

  • 注释:虽然不建议使用三引号字符串作为注释,但可以用于多行注释。
"""
这是一个多行注释
"""
  • 多行文档字符串:用于定义类、函数或模块的文档字符串。
def my_function(): """ 这是一个多行文档字符串 用于描述函数的功能 """ pass
  • 多行字符串字面量:用于存储或显示多行文本。
long_text = """
这是一个很长的文本
包含了多行内容
"""

通过以上内容,相信您已经了解了Python中三引号的输入方法及其用途。

评论
一个月内的热帖推荐
csdn大佬
Lv.1普通用户

452398

帖子

22

小组

841

积分

赞助商广告
站长交流